commit c39ee1a532e41c6eb9a8829e3301ed71939cf7dd
Author: Hakan Candar <hakancandar@protonmail.com>
Date: Fri Apr 18 07:08:44 2025 -0600
[PATCH] riscv: Add support for riscv*-gnu (GNU/Hurd on RISC-V)
This produces a toolchain that can successfully build binaries targeting
riscv*-gnu.
gcc/ChangeLog:
* config.gcc: Recognize riscv*-*-gnu* targets.
* config/riscv/gnu.h: New file.
(cherry picked from commit 869f2ab30ad53033ad6ac82569d74ce3a99fe510)
